- Description
- TWO LIGHT STAINED GLASS WINDOW. DEPICTS ST MICHAEL, PURPLE WINGS AND NIMBUS, (LEFT) WITH WREATH AND SWORD AND ST GABRIEL, BLUE WINGS AND NIMBUS, (RIGHT) WITH WREATH AND LILLIES
- Inscription
- THE PEACE OF GOD WHICH PASSETH ALL UNDERSTANDING/ IN LOVING MEMORY OF/ DAVID FITZHARDINGE KINGSCOTE/ KILLED FLYING IN BURMA/ SEPTEMBER 1945 AGED 20
